Imani Edu-Tainers African Dance Company

Promoting community awareness, appreciation, and understanding of African culture.
Imani Edu-Tainers African Dance Company is a not-for- profit organization founded in 1992 by Sonya Mann-McFarlane in Chapel Hill, NC. Sonya relocated to Lancaster, PA in 1993 and continues to promote community awareness, appreciation, and understanding of African culture and community enlightenment. The performing company (supported by the organization) has received rave reviews for performances and presentations in Lancaster County and beyond.
